Jewelry
During 2009, we decided to discontinue the domestic manufacturing, product development and sourcing activities of our jewelry business, and also announced the closing of our jewelry distribution center during 2010.  We accrued $0.1 million and $0.2 million of lease termination costs in the fiscal nine months ended October 1, 2011 and September 29, 2012, respectively.  These costs are reported as SG&A expenses in the domestic wholesale footwear and accessories segment.

Texas Warehouse
On December 1, 2009, we announced the closing of warehouse facilities in Socorro, Texas.  We accrued $3.4 million of termination benefits and associated employee costs for 220 employees.  We also recorded $7.4 million of lease obligation costs relating to the warehouse.  These costs are reported as SG&A expenses in the domestic wholesale jeanswear segment.  The closing was substantially completed by the end of April 2010.

Retail Stores
We continue to review our retail operations for underperforming locations.  As a result of this review, we have decided to close domestic retail locations that no longer provide strategic benefits.  During the first fiscal nine months of 2011 and 2012, we closed 78 and 85 locations, respectively, and we anticipate closing additional locations in 2012.  Total termination benefits and associated employee costs are expected to be $10.8 million for approximately 2,020 employees, including both store employees and administrative support personnel.  We recorded $1.2 million and $1.6 million of employee termination costs in the fiscal nine months ended October 1, 2011 and September 29, 2012, respectively.  In connection with our decision to close these stores, we reviewed the associated long-term assets for impairments.  As a result of this review, we recorded $4.7 million and $0.4 million of impairment losses during the fiscal nine months ended October 1, 2011 and September 29, 2012, respectively, on leasehold improvements and furniture and fixtures located in the stores to be closed.  These costs are reported as SG&A expenses in our domestic retail segment.
